    Subject[PATCH v19 109/130] KVM: TDX: Handle TDX PV port io hypercall
    Date
    From: Isaku Yamahata <isaku.yamahata@intel.com>

    Wire up TDX PV port IO hypercall to the KVM backend function.

    Signed-off-by: Isaku Yamahata <isaku.yamahata@intel.com>
    Reviewed-by: Paolo Bonzini <pbonzini@redhat.com>
    ---
    v18:
    - Fix out case to set R10 and R11 correctly when user space handled port
    out.
    ---
    arch/x86/kvm/vmx/tdx.c | 67 ++++++++++++++++++++++++++++++++++++++++++
    1 file changed, 67 insertions(+)

    diff --git a/arch/x86/kvm/vmx/tdx.c b/arch/x86/kvm/vmx/tdx.c
    index a2caf2ae838c..55fc6cc6c816 100644
    --- a/arch/x86/kvm/vmx/tdx.c
    +++ b/arch/x86/kvm/vmx/tdx.c
    @@ -1152,6 +1152,71 @@ static int tdx_emulate_hlt(struct kvm_vcpu *vcpu)
    return kvm_emulate_halt_noskip(vcpu);
    }

    +static int tdx_complete_pio_out(struct kvm_vcpu *vcpu)
    +{
    + tdvmcall_set_return_code(vcpu, TDVMCALL_SUCCESS);
    + tdvmcall_set_return_val(vcpu, 0);
    + return 1;
    +}
    +
    +static int tdx_complete_pio_in(struct kvm_vcpu *vcpu)
    +{
    + struct x86_emulate_ctxt *ctxt = vcpu->arch.emulate_ctxt;
    + unsigned long val = 0;
    + int ret;
    +
    + WARN_ON_ONCE(vcpu->arch.pio.count != 1);
    +
    + ret = ctxt->ops->pio_in_emulated(ctxt, vcpu->arch.pio.size,
    + vcpu->arch.pio.port, &val, 1);
    + WARN_ON_ONCE(!ret);
    +
    + tdvmcall_set_return_code(vcpu, TDVMCALL_SUCCESS);
    + tdvmcall_set_return_val(vcpu, val);
    +
    + return 1;
    +}
    +
    +static int tdx_emulate_io(struct kvm_vcpu *vcpu)
    +{
    + struct x86_emulate_ctxt *ctxt = vcpu->arch.emulate_ctxt;
    + unsigned long val = 0;
    + unsigned int port;
    + int size, ret;
    + bool write;
    +
    + ++vcpu->stat.io_exits;
    +
    + size = tdvmcall_a0_read(vcpu);
    + write = tdvmcall_a1_read(vcpu);
    + port = tdvmcall_a2_read(vcpu);
    +
    + if (size != 1 && size != 2 && size != 4) {
    + tdvmcall_set_return_code(vcpu, TDVMCALL_INVALID_OPERAND);
    + return 1;
    + }
    +
    + if (write) {
    + val = tdvmcall_a3_read(vcpu);
    + ret = ctxt->ops->pio_out_emulated(ctxt, size, port, &val, 1);
    +
    + /* No need for a complete_userspace_io callback. */
    + vcpu->arch.pio.count = 0;
    + } else
    + ret = ctxt->ops->pio_in_emulated(ctxt, size, port, &val, 1);
    +
    + if (ret)
    + tdvmcall_set_return_val(vcpu, val);
    + else {
    + if (write)
    + vcpu->arch.complete_userspace_io = tdx_complete_pio_out;
    + else
    + vcpu->arch.complete_userspace_io = tdx_complete_pio_in;
    + }
    +
    + return ret;
    +}
    +
    static int handle_tdvmcall(struct kvm_vcpu *vcpu)
    {
    if (tdvmcall_exit_type(vcpu))
    @@ -1162,6 +1227,8 @@ static int handle_tdvmcall(struct kvm_vcpu *vcpu)
    return tdx_emulate_cpuid(vcpu);
    case EXIT_REASON_HLT:
    return tdx_emulate_hlt(vcpu);
    + case EXIT_REASON_IO_INSTRUCTION:
    + return tdx_emulate_io(vcpu);
    default:
    break;
    }
